FAQs for Mercure Ayr Hotel
Does Mercure Ayr Hotel offer free cancellation for a full refund? Yes, Mercure Ayr Hotel does have fully refundable rooms available to book on our site, which can be cancelled up to a few days before check-in. Just make sure to check this property's cancellation policy for the exact terms and conditions. What are the cleanliness and hygiene measures currently in place at Mercure Ayr Hotel? This property confirms that disinfectant is used to clean the property. Furthermore, guests are provided with hand sanitizer, social distancing measures are in place, and requires staff to wear personal protective equipment. Please note that this information has been provided by our partners. Is parking offered on site at Mercure Ayr Hotel? Yes. Self parking costs GBP 3.00 per day. Is there a pool at Mercure Ayr Hotel? Yes, there's an indoor pool. Are pets allowed at Mercure Ayr Hotel? Sorry, pets aren't allowed. What are the check-in and check-out times at Mercure Ayr Hotel? You can check in from 3:00 PM - anytime. Check-out time is 11:00 AM. Late check-out is available for a charge (subject to availability). Express check-in and check-out and contactless check-in and check-out are available. Are there restaurants at or near Mercure Ayr Hotel? Yes, there's an onsite restaurant. Nearby restaurants include West Of The Moon (3-min walk), The Wellington Restaurant (3-min walk), and Cecchini's (3-min walk). What is there to do at Mercure Ayr Hotel and nearby? Mercure Ayr Hotel has a spa and an indoor pool, as well as a steam room.

Looks pretty drab from the outside, the car park didn’t fill me with confidence that ,y car would be ok. However inside the hotel was clean and modern. Our room was large with a king bed, although it faced the sun and as extremely hot, we asked for and got a fan. The shower was powerful and hot.
